Spisu treści:

Co oznacza NR w awk?
Co oznacza NR w awk?

Wideo: Co oznacza NR w awk?

Wideo: Co oznacza NR w awk?
Wideo: Light Fruit Looks INSANE Awakened... (Roblox Bloxfruit) 2024, Może
Anonim

NR to a AWK wbudowana zmienna i oznacza liczbę przetwarzanych rekordów. Stosowanie: NR może być użyty w bloku akcji reprezentuje numer przetwarzanej linii i jeśli to jest używane w END it Móc drukuj liczbę całkowicie przetworzonych wierszy. Przykład: za pomocą NR aby wydrukować numer wiersza w pliku za pomocą AWK.

Tutaj, czym jest NR Linux?

NR oznacza liczbę rekordów w pliku wejściowym. NR jest numerem bieżącego rekordu/linii, a nie liczbą rekordów w pliku. Tylko w bloku END (lub w ostatniej linii pliku) jest to liczba linii w pliku.

Poza powyższym, czym jest FNR w Uniksie? W awk, FNR odnosi się do numeru rekordu (zazwyczaj numeru wiersza) w bieżącym pliku, a NR odnosi się do całkowitego numeru rekordu. Ten wzorzec jest zwykle używany do wykonywania akcji tylko na pierwszym pliku.

Tak więc, czym jest polecenie awk w Linuksie na przykładzie?

Polecenie AWK w systemie Unix / Linux z przykładami . Awk to język skryptowy używany do manipulowania danymi i generowania raportów. ten polecenie awk język programowania nie wymaga kompilacji i pozwala użytkownikowi używać zmiennych, funkcji numerycznych, funkcji łańcuchowych i operatorów logicznych.

Jak korzystasz z gawk?

Polecenie gawk może służyć do:

  1. Skanuje plik wiersz po wierszu.
  2. Dzieli każdy wiersz wejściowy na pola.
  3. Porównuje wiersz/pola wejściowe z wzorcem.
  4. Wykonuje działania na dopasowanych liniach.
  5. Przekształć pliki danych.
  6. Twórz sformatowane raporty.
  7. Formatuj wiersze wyjściowe.
  8. Operacje arytmetyczne i łańcuchowe.

Zalecana: